Transaction 32dfa4cf4880d145af07dfc14b23cde0069e93e1198ef13a78d82128207b515d

2 Input
1 Outputs
  • 32dfa4cf4880d145af07dfc14b23cde0069e93e1198ef13a78d82128207b515d:0
  • value  1741579
    address  13Ee2auX7TLy9cqGXxN1pHWptBNu4u352K